White glazed stem bowl, late Jin-early Yuan dynasty, China, 13th century. A white glazed stemmed bowl from Huoxian kiln, Shanxi province, the steeply rounded sides have a flared rim and numerous concentric potting lines springing from a short, hollow, splayed stem. It is covered overall with a transparent ivory-tinted glaze of Ding type pooling slightly on the interior, with five small, neat spur marks in the centre. The unglazed base of the stem reveals the white porcellaneous ware and five additional spur marks on the rim of the stem.
Bath (England), The Museum of East Asian Art
